Output dd3b7e780453586fa61fd85256fbf62e053f41761b8a9584bfd96536518f615b:2

value
3481915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 664845da2116e3c48c2a72950b706441b2539bba OP_EQUAL
address
3B1qRiXVqFnxmENAdipnz1XxMj8cEmrpYk
transaction
dd3b7e780453586fa61fd85256fbf62e053f41761b8a9584bfd96536518f615b